                      • cvp
                        cvp @madivad last edited by

                        @madivad said:

                        I have grown accustomed to running my apps in the cloud version

                        If you need to run an iCloud script with the App Store version, you could try to run
                        this script, passing it as 1st argument, the folder/script_name.py. Other arguments may follow.
                        I've tested it with the beta because I don't have anymore the normal version.

                        #!python2
                        # force this script to use Python 2 Interpreter so you can start
                        # Python 3 Interpreter to run your iCloud script
                        from objc_util import *	
                        import sys
                        arg = sys.argv
                        # this script = arg[0]
                        script = arg[1]
                        path = '/private/var/mobile/Library/Mobile Documents/iCloud~com~omz-software~Pythonista3/Documents/' + script
                        arg = arg[2:]	# other arguments
                        I3=ObjCClass('PYK3Interpreter').sharedInterpreter()
                        # run a script like in wrench menu (path, args, reset env yes/no)
                        #print(path,script)
                        I3.runScriptAtPath_argv_resetEnvironment_(path, arg, True)

                                            mithrendal last edited by mithrendal

                                            the beta expired. I did not delete it ! I just reinstalled the old appstore version. After the download completed, now pythonista starts again. All my data was still there.
